Position Overview
We’re seeking a Building Code & Zoning Specialist to join our Code & Zoning team. In this role, you’ll serve as a subject matter expert, guiding clients through complex building code and zoning requirements. You’ll collaborate with design professionals, project teams, and regulatory agencies to ensure compliance and support successful project outcomes.
What You’ll Do
- Review design plans for compliance with NYC and regional zoning and building codes.
- Conduct due diligence for proposed developments and prepare technical documentation.
- Advise clients on achieving compliance and resolving code-related issues.
- Represent Milrose at project and agency meetings; liaise with city, state, and town officials.
- Prepare variance requests, determinations, and zoning/building code reports.
- Train staff on code updates and best practices.
- Support business development by identifying new opportunities and contributing to service growth.
What You’ll Bring
- Bachelor’s degree in Architecture, Engineering, Urban Planning, or related field.
- 10+ years of experience on complex, large-scale projects.
- Strong knowledge of NYC Zoning Resolution, Building Code, and regional codes.
- Excellent organ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el.
Preferred
- RA, PE, or NYC Department of Buildings Class 2 Filing Representative License.
- Familiarity with construction methodologies and approval processes.
